Minister Dačić met with the head of the OSCE Mission in Kosovo and Metohija

09. Dec 2022.
First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Serbia Ivica Dačić met today with Ambassador Michael Davenport, head of the OSCE Mission in Kosovo and Metohija (OMiK).

On that occasion, Ambassador Davenport congratulated on the establishment of the new Government of the Republic of Serbia and personally congratulated Minister Dačić on the appointment to the post of First Vice President and Minister of Foreign Affairs.

The importance of the work of the OMIK Mission was emphasised at the meeting, especially the respect for the status neutrality of this OSCE field mission, during the mandate of which the respect for human rights, the rights of communities and the strengthening of democratic institutions are being monitored.

They also discussed the latest developments in Kosovo and Metohija, with a mutual assessment that it is necessary to preserve peace and reduce tensions while returning to dialogue, which is in mutual interest.

The expectation that the successful cooperation with the new Government of the Republic of Serbia would continue was also expressed.
